31,492,160 is a composite number, even.
31,492,160 (thirty-one million four hundred ninety-two thousand one hundred sixty) is an even 8-digit number. It is a composite number with 112 divisors, and factors as 2⁶ × 5 × 7 × 17 × 827. Its proper divisors sum to 59,362,624, more than the number itself, making it an abundant number. Written other ways, in hexadecimal, 0x1E08840.
